Statistics and data analytics in industrial automation involve the collection, analysis, and interpretation of data to optimize processes, improve decision-making, and enhance overall efficiency. By harnessing the power of data, companies can gain valuable insights into their operations, identify areas for improvement, and make data-driven decisions to drive performance. One of the main benefits of incorporating statistics and data analytics into industrial automation in New Zealand is the ability to predict and prevent equipment failures through predictive maintenance. By utilizing historical data and real-time monitoring, companies can identify patterns and trends that indicate when a machine is likely to fail, allowing for timely intervention to avoid costly downtime. Furthermore, data analytics can also be used to optimize production processes by identifying bottlenecks, reducing waste, and improving overall efficiency. Through the analysis of performance metrics and key performance indicators, companies can streamline operations, increase output, and meet customer demands more effectively.
